“Stop Asking for Transport Money, Ask for Flights”: Nigerian Lady’s Take on Relationship Finances Sparks Debate

A Nigerian woman has ignited discussions on social media after sharing her controversial views on how women should handle financial support in relationships.

In a viral video shared on X (formerly Twitter), she advised women to stop asking men for small things like transport fare, suggesting instead that they aim for “bigger gestures” such as flight bookings.

As a girl, if you’re still collecting transport fare from men in 2026, that’s ghetto. Let him book your flight instead,” she said.

She explained that once a man demonstrates willingness to spend on something substantial, like a flight ticket, it becomes easier for women to request smaller items for personal upkeep, lifestyle needs, and shopping.

Then you can start with the small requests; nails, lashes, hair, and shopping. Normally he’ll do all that since he already paid for the flight,” she added.

According to her, men are less likely to decline smaller requests after spending on bigger ones, as they wouldn’t want the money already spent to go to waste.
